The Role of Omega-6 in Cellular Function
Omega-6 fatty acids are a family of polyunsaturated fats with the most common dietary form being linoleic acid (LA). Once ingested, LA can be converted into other crucial omega-6s, such as arachidonic acid (AA). These fatty acids are integral components of cell membranes throughout the body, including the brain, skeletal muscles, liver, and immune cells. By influencing the fluidity and structure of these membranes, omega-6s directly impact how cells communicate and function. This foundational role means that a sufficient intake of these fats is necessary for normal growth and development.
Heart Health Benefits
One of the most well-documented benefits of omega-6 fatty acids relates to cardiovascular health. When consumed in moderation and used to replace saturated fats in the diet, omega-6s have been shown to lower harmful LDL cholesterol and improve overall blood lipid profiles. A large meta-analysis published in the American Journal of Clinical Nutrition found that replacing saturated fats with polyunsaturated fats (including both omega-6 and omega-3) significantly reduced heart disease rates. The American Heart Association has also supported the cardiovascular benefits of including omega-6 fats in the diet.
The Function of Omega-6 in Skin Health
For maintaining healthy, hydrated, and resilient skin, linoleic acid is a critical component.
- Reinforces the Skin Barrier: LA is an essential constituent of ceramides, a type of lipid that helps form the skin's moisture barrier, preventing water loss.
- Hydrates and Soothes: By retaining moisture within the epidermal cells, linoleic acid keeps the skin supple and soft. It also has natural anti-inflammatory properties that can help soothe irritated skin.
- Aids in Acne Management: People with acne-prone skin often have lower levels of LA in their sebum. Supplementing with or applying LA topically can help regulate sebum production and reduce blemishes.
Addressing the Inflammation Debate
For years, omega-6 fatty acids were unfairly vilified for their connection to inflammation. The theory was that because omega-6s can be converted into pro-inflammatory eicosanoids, a high intake would lead to chronic inflammation. However, this is a vastly oversimplified view. The body also converts arachidonic acid (a derivative of linoleic acid) into anti-inflammatory compounds, and robust studies have shown that high omega-6 intake does not increase markers of inflammation. The true issue is not the presence of omega-6s, but rather the imbalance with omega-3 fatty acids, which have potent anti-inflammatory effects. Modern Western diets are often heavily skewed towards omega-6s, with ratios as high as 15:1 or more, whereas a healthier balance is closer to 4:1 or lower. Focusing on balancing this ratio rather than demonizing omega-6 is the key to managing inflammation and promoting health.
Potential Benefits for Brain Function and Reproduction
While omega-3s are more famously associated with cognitive health, omega-6s also contribute significantly, particularly arachidonic acid (AA), which is one of the most abundant fatty acids in the brain. It plays a vital role in cellular membrane integrity, neural signaling, and cognitive function. Recent research has even suggested that AA supplementation may offer cognitive benefits, especially for the aging population. Furthermore, both omega-3 and omega-6 fatty acids are crucial for reproductive health in both men and women, impacting hormone production, blood flow, and sperm cell membrane integrity.
Omega-6 vs. Omega-3: The Right Balance
| Feature | Omega-6 Fatty Acids | Omega-3 Fatty Acids |
|---|---|---|
| Primary Function | Cell membrane structure, energy, immune response | Reduces inflammation, supports brain and heart health |
| Key Dietary Source | Vegetable oils (sunflower, corn, soybean), nuts, seeds | Fatty fish (salmon, tuna), flaxseed oil, walnuts |
| Inflammatory Role | Precursor to both pro- and anti-inflammatory compounds | Converts to less inflammatory compounds and helps resolve inflammation |
| Optimal Ratio | Important to balance with omega-3; Western diets often have a high ratio | Aim for a lower omega-6 to omega-3 ratio, ideally below 4:1 |
| Essentiality | Essential fat; the body cannot produce it | Essential fat; must be obtained through diet |
| Deficiency Signs | Dry skin, hair loss, reproductive issues | Fatigue, dry skin, mood swings |
What if Your Omega-6 Intake is Too High?
Given the abundance of omega-6 in processed foods and vegetable oils, most Western diets provide plenty, often leading to a disproportionately high omega-6 to omega-3 ratio. This imbalance, rather than high omega-6 intake itself, is thought to be a contributing factor to chronic inflammatory conditions. Signs of this imbalance are often subtle and can mimic other deficiencies, emphasizing the importance of a well-rounded diet. To improve the balance, it's not about eliminating omega-6s, but rather increasing omega-3 intake from sources like fatty fish, walnuts, and chia seeds.
